Do Personalized Vitamins Work? What the Research Actually Says
The question do personalized vitamins work is both valid and timely, especially as personalized supplements gain popularity. Whether browsing a pharmacy or exploring wellness brands online, you’ll find generic multivitamins alongside tailored subscription services promising customized nutrition. But does personalization truly offer better benefits, or is it just smart marketing? The answer is nuanced. This article reviews current scientific research, highlights where evidence is strong or limited, and helps you decide if personalized vitamins are a good fit for your health.
What “Personalized Supplements” Actually Means
Personalized nutrition ranges from simple questionnaires about lifestyle and diet to advanced testing like blood biomarkers, genetic analysis, or microbiome profiling. Most consumer services rely on self-reported data to recommend blends of vitamins, minerals, and botanicals tailored to individual profiles. This approach differs from standard multivitamins, which are formulated for average population needs and may not address specific deficiencies or absorption differences.
What the Research Says About Personalized Nutrition
Scientific studies on personalized nutrition are growing but still emerging. A landmark 2015 study in Cell by Zeevi et al. showed that people respond differently to the same foods due to factors like gut microbiome and lifestyle, supporting the idea that one-size-fits-all recommendations may not work for everyone.
More directly related to supplements, a systematic review on PubMed found that tailored dietary advice, including personalized supplement recommendations, led to modest but consistent improvements in nutritional biomarkers compared to generic advice. This suggests that personalization has a physiological basis, though it’s not a cure-all.
Nutrigenomics—the study of how genetics influence nutrient metabolism—adds depth. For example, gene variants like MTHFR and VDR affect folate processing and vitamin D receptor sensitivity, respectively. People with these variants might need adjusted supplement doses. However, translating genetic data into clinical recommendations remains a developing field with some findings yet to be fully validated.
How Personalization Addresses Individual Nutritional Needs
Personalized supplements recognize that nutritional needs vary widely based on age, sex, diet, health status, and environment. For instance, a 55-year-old postmenopausal woman in northern Europe eating a plant-based diet has different micronutrient requirements than a 28-year-old omnivore in the Mediterranean.
Generic multivitamins aim to cover broad populations safely but often include nutrients in amounts that may be insufficient or unnecessary for individuals. They may also omit nutrients that some people need. Personalized supplements, even those based on well-designed questionnaires, can identify likely gaps—such as low iron, B12 deficiency, or vitamin D insufficiency—and prioritize those nutrients accordingly.

Do Personalized Vitamins Work? Comparing Them to Standard Multivitamins
Ingredient Relevance
Standard multivitamins often include 20+ micronutrients, many of which an individual may not need. Some combinations can even hinder absorption, such as calcium interfering with iron uptake. Personalized formulations can focus on needed nutrients and use forms with better bioavailability tailored to the individual.
Dosing Appropriateness
Reference Nutrient Intakes (RNIs) are designed for population averages, not individuals. For example, someone with vitamin D deficiency requires doses higher than those in typical multivitamins. Personalized supplements can adjust doses based on specific needs, which standard products usually cannot.
Compliance and Engagement
People tend to stick with supplements more consistently when they feel the product is tailored to them. Studies show personalized nutrition advice improves adherence, which is crucial since even the best supplements are ineffective if not taken regularly.
Limitations and Honest Caveats
While promising, the research on personalized vitamins has limitations. Most clinical trials focus on broader dietary interventions rather than quiz-based supplement blends common in the consumer market. The quality and rigor of personalization vary widely between brands.
“Personalized” can sometimes be a marketing term without substantial scientific backing. Ingredient quality, bioavailability, and formulation rigor differ, so a personalized label alone doesn’t guarantee effectiveness.
Supplements should complement, not replace, a nutrient-rich diet. No supplement can replicate the complexity of whole foods. Also, some nutrients—especially fat-soluble vitamins like A, D, E, and K—can accumulate and cause toxicity if overdosed. Personalized protocols should respect safe upper limits and involve healthcare guidance when necessary.
What Experts and Clinicians Generally Think
Nutrition professionals generally support personalized approaches grounded in solid evidence. They emphasize the importance of understanding what data informs recommendations, whether those recommendations align with peer-reviewed science, and if products meet quality standards.
Consumers should ask: Are recommendations based on reliable data? Are doses safe and appropriate? Is the product manufactured to recognized standards? If answers are clear and transparent, the service likely offers genuine value. If personalization seems superficial, it may not be worth the investment.

How to Assess Whether Personalized Vitamins Are Right for You
Personalized supplements aren’t necessary for everyone. If you eat a varied, nutrient-dense diet and have no known deficiencies or absorption issues, a basic supplement or none at all may suffice. However, personalization can be valuable in certain situations:
-
Restrictive diets: Vegans, vegetarians, and those with allergies may need nutrients like B12, iron, omega-3s, or calcium that generic supplements might not cover adequately.
-
Life stage changes: Pregnancy, menopause, and aging alter nutritional needs that standard multivitamins may not fully address.
-
Geographic factors: Limited sun exposure increases vitamin D requirements, especially in northern climates.
-
Known deficiencies: Blood tests revealing specific nutrient gaps call for targeted supplementation rather than broad-spectrum products.
-
Chronic conditions: Certain health issues and medications affect nutrient absorption and metabolism, making personalized guidance important.

A Reasonable Conclusion
The evidence supports the principle behind personalized vitamins: individual nutritional needs vary, and tailored recommendations can be more effective than generic advice. This principle is well-founded in nutritional science. However, not all products claiming personalization deliver meaningful benefits, especially those relying solely on questionnaires without clinical data.
When a personalized supplement service uses sound methodology, quality ingredients, appropriate dosing, and transparent reasoning, it is likely more beneficial than a generic multivitamin for people with identifiable gaps. Personalized vitamins are not medical treatments but can be a valuable part of a holistic health approach that includes a balanced diet, regular exercise, and professional medical care.
Healthy skepticism is important—focus it on the specific service rather than the concept itself.
Frequently Asked Questions
Are personalized vitamins scientifically proven to work?
Research supports the core idea that individual nutritional needs vary and that tailored advice improves nutritional biomarkers more effectively than generic guidance. However, evidence for consumer quiz-based products is less robust than for clinically supervised or biomarker-driven personalization. The quality of personalization varies by provider.
How do personalized vitamins differ from regular multivitamins?
Regular multivitamins target population averages and include many nutrients that may not be needed by every individual. Personalized vitamins use individual data—such as diet, lifestyle, health goals, and sometimes biomarkers—to select nutrients and doses better suited to a person’s specific needs.
Can personalized supplements improve health outcomes?
Personalized supplements can improve nutritional status, especially when addressing specific deficiencies. While they are not treatments for disease, correcting nutrient gaps can enhance wellbeing and certain health markers. Personalization increases the chance of targeting the right nutrients.
What research supports personalized vitamin use?
The Food4Me study, a large European randomized trial, showed that personalized dietary advice, including supplement guidance, led to better diet quality and improved nutritional biomarkers than generic advice. Nutrigenomics research also identifies gene variants affecting nutrient metabolism, providing a rationale for personalized dosing in some cases.
Are there risks to personalized vitamin supplementation?
Risks exist but are manageable with responsible providers. Fat-soluble vitamins (A, D, E, K) can accumulate to toxic levels if overdosed. Some nutrients interact with medications (e.g., vitamin K and blood thinners). Reputable services stay within safe limits and recommend professional advice when appropriate.
